In 2024, the University of Michigan (U-M) Medical School rolled out a lab safety awareness contest for research laboratories. A quiz was developed that included questions related to biological and chemical research and addressed frequent and/or high-risk inspection deficiencies and incidents on the medical campus. Prizes were chosen that supported and improved safety in the areas the quiz covered. There will be time for Q&A.

Apr 26, 2019 | MABioN Webinar – An introduction to the principles of plant pathology

Similar to animals, plants are targeted by a variety of pathogenic organisms. Unlike animals however, fungal infections are the most damaging and contain the must numerous pathogenic species. In addition to fungal infections, plants also suffer extensively from bacteria, viruses, and nematodes. A better understanding of the life cycles, infection cycles, and survival structures of all of these organisms will help promote safe handling, research, and disposal of these highly destructive pathogens.
